Job Summary: 

The role applies an understanding of business processes, gathers data, makes recommendations and provides administrative support to the Chief Revenue Officer and other assigned C-Suite Staff members, as assigned; assists executives by managing issues related to people and processes with minimal supervision.

Job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Facilitates and manages the Executive's accessibility and open lines of communication with staff; interfaces with internal and external customers on behalf of Executive and company
  • Meets regularly with Executive(s) to review status of projects; plan key events, meetings and travel and prioritize open action items
  •  Oversees the Revenue team's operating calendar, helping senior Sales leaders plan and execute their QBRs, MBRs, etc.
  • Manages and maintains the Executive’s calendar in G-Suite; applies understanding of executive priorities in scheduling meetings
  • Prepares travel arrangements (domestic and international) and creates detailed itineraries; may also arrange travel for visiting executives and VIPs
  • Prepares, reviews, submits and tracks Executive's expense reports
  • Organizes and maintains confidential files for the Executive; identifies and drives best practices related to document management and confidential data
  • Creates and maintains reports, spreadsheets, and other necessary documents in response to anticipation of executive's needs; screens, prioritizes and redirects/forwards phone calls; manages call-back list; responds to callers with routine requests, as well as those requiring additional research and investigation
  • Interacts and communicates with all levels within the company; develops effective networks with peers throughout Reltio, as well as external professional groups
  • Collaboratively performs research, collects materials, and maintains files which include relevant collateral and other information used by the executive in communications; takes and notes from meetings, identifies action items and schedules reminders for the executive
  • Maintains department organization charts and email groups
  • Works with peers to execute approved project activities
  • Enters tracks and processes departmental expenses and invoices for payment with peers to understand and enhance the value of the EA role
  • Provides support and acts as back up for other Executive Assistants as needed
  • Other duties and responsibilities as may be assigned
